Abstract: (WSP)
We study supersymmetric quantum mechanics with particular emphasis on scattering relations and coupled channels. We discuss channels with different masses, the threshold behavior of supersymmetric S-matrix partners, phase equivalence, and the appearance and disappearance of S-matrix poles.
